STORY
━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━

As one of the dragons who founded the clan with Venin, Norok is highly respected in the lair. Not that she cares. The prestige is meaningless to her. All Norok wants to do is fight things. She itches for it. Her uncanny gift is a knack for precipitate violence and she knows how to use that skill to devastating effect. Norok is a scrappy fighter who doesn't much care for tactics, she likes to feel a battle and react accordingly. Fond of head long rushes and surprise guerilla warfare style approaches, she's either seen coming or she's not and no matter which she's a horrifying force to be reckoned with. Often her size is underestimated much to the misfortune of her enemies.

She is the head hunters, the first among the guard and the best warrior they have. Norok takes her job quite seriously (she is a serious dragon) but has long since altered her warrior-of-all-trades role within the clan to simply the most vicious. She doesn’t have much of a head for planning, being more of an ‘act now, think later’ type dragon, so she leaves all that to other less useful dragons. Instead she takes a very claws-on approach to her job and likes to be in the thick of the fray. Diplomacy is not her thing, she sends other (more tactful) dragons whenever greeting new faces.

Her innate suspicion of everyone makes her prickly and abrasive. It takes a very strong personality to put up with her. Norok is the sort of dragon who one always knows exactly where they stand with, she doesn’t hold her punches, doesn’t gloss over things or sugar coat her words; she speaks her mind and isn’t afraid to state how she feels about someone. No matter whether she’s being critical. She may not be very good at social situations, but that’s not what her job entails. When Venin saved her, she decided to pay her debt in the same way as Inerri: through service. Norok acknowledges Kieri’s role as the new leader, sure, but her primary allegiance will probably always lie with Venin. Not that anyone needs to know that. Besides, she’s a dragon of action, any negotiating or whatever nonsense needs to happen, Daeddrin can see to. Or Ravelin. The other warriors of the clan all defer to her and Norok is fully ready to delegate the jobs she doesn’t like. The only warrior in the clan that doesn’t listen to her is Xhinhai. A bit of a recluse, her enormous fighting capabilities are enough to earn her Norok’s grudging respect. So long as Xhinhai doesn’t hinder her work, Norok is fine with letting her do her own thing.

Norok’s complete lack of social ability combined with her brusque always-angry seeming demeanour mean she doesn’t have many friends. Not really. Denara might be the closest thing to a friend she has in the clan. And that’s fine with Norok, truly. She lost her pack when she was younger and her interpersonal development suffered because of it, resulting in her more solitary nature (an anomaly for Mirrors). But her inability to make friends is somewhat of an understatement when it came to Inerri. They have always been such different dragons and they never got along. Gentle, pacifistic Inerri has even raised her voice at Norok in the past. Thankfully, however, they have both mellowed with age, and while their interactions are still sort of frosty, they’ve finally learned how to live with each other.


OTHER
━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━
ORIGIN / A Plague clan she can do without remembering, honestly. The victim of a coup, she was exiled in an attempt to make the clan’s leaders – her parents – puppets. They fled after her and got themselves killed. She’s lucky to be alive. Now, she takes changes with grudging acceptance. She hated the idea of the alliance with the Beastfolk, initially, quietly convinced they would start a coup and her past would repeat. Instead, she met Eodri, a raptorik warrior who has since become her companion. Norok learns as much from him as he from her. So perhaps all change isn’t awful.

Fact / Her armour was the first forged by Yesterday. Improvements were constantly forced upon her by the inventive Wildclaw, but Norok could do without the uncertainty of change. Her resistance inevitably proved futile. Now that Yesterday is gone, the forge claimed by her apprentice, Achara, several individuals have pointed out that she could do away with the armour. No one would stop her. Norok continues to wear it anyway and no matter how dented it becomes she won’t let Achara replace it. She denies it’s because she misses the Wildclaw.

Likes / She has a collection of weapons that she finds fascinating; she has no interest in using weapons herself (she is a weapon) but she likes to keep them anyway. Norok prefers to fight head on and enjoys when a battlefield caters to that.

Dislikes / Being told that they’re solving this problem with diplomacy. Why does she even stay? Equally frustrating is being told that they ‘need a plan’. She doesn’t need a plan; she just needs to fight things. She also can’t abide those who won’t follow orders, she knows what she’s doing and she doesn’t need idiots running off getting killed.

Interests / While she’s mostly fond of patrolling and fighting, she also enjoys an afternoon out hunting. It’s slower and softer than a battle, but she finds it therapeutic in some indefinable way. Fen is good company for a hunt and sometimes she goes with him, but often she prefers to be alone. Thankfully, Fen doesn’t mind, he’s of the same opinion. Unlike Fen, Norok doesn’t keep trophies or anything like that, whatever she hunts is given to the clan.
